Frozen Pipe Water Removal Cost in Johnston, RI

The cost of frozen pipe water removal in Johnston, RI, varies dep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. These estimates are based on average costs and may vary depending on your specific situation.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water Extraction $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area, amount of water extracted
Drying and Dehumidification $1,000 – $5,000 Size of affected area, amount of drying equipment needed
Sanitizing and Disinfecting $500 – $2,000 Type of sanitizing agents used, size of affected area

Q: Can I prevent frozen pipes from bursting?

A: Yes, you can prevent frozen pipes from bursting by insulating exposed pipes, keeping your home warm, and allowing cold water to drip from the faucet served by exposed pipes.
